ADA: Vertical Platform Lifts (Wheelchair Lifts) Instead of an Elevator

April 28, 2013 By Karen Koch

So you are looking for a solution for accessing an upper level of your home but are not sure if you want to spend the $28,000.00 or more to build a shaft, a pit, and possibly alter the roof line of your home to install an elevator?
Vertical Platform Lifts

This units are available up to 14′ of vertical travel with openings on 3 sides. They can either be set into a 3″ pit or rest on your existing floor with a 3″ ramp leading up to the platform for barrier free access.

Platform lifts can be installed either indoors or outdoors with an enclosure by the manufacturer or enclosed with a structure that you create. These are a cost-effective accessibility solution for any structure including offices, homes and full commercial buildings.

By using an innovative 1:2 cable hydraulic lift or screw drives, these products are available in multi configurations to meet your requirements.

We can also configure your unit with an emergency battery back-up system for lowering and raising your lift in case of a power supply outage. Additional safety features include In Car Stop Switch, Alarm Buzzer, Final Limit Switch, Anti-Slip Flooring and optional 2 way communication phone connections.
